We are a remote-first, international SaaS company helping businesses maximise their revenue potential in Europe and the US with our Go-To-Market Platform. We are the successful merger of Leadfeeder and Echobot, bringing two industry leaders together.

What makes us unique? With origins in Finland and Germany, the country with the highest privacy standards in Europe, Dealfront was born with compliance and transparency in its DNA. This ensures that our users know exactly where their data originated. Compliance does not affect companies' earnings.

We have over 330 dealfronters around the world in 40 countries. Join us and help us continue our mission to be the leading Go-To-Market platform that helps B2B companies win deals in Europe.

Position Overview

Reporting to the CEO, we’re looking for an experienced and dynamic VP of Marketing who will lead a growing function of 25+ marketeers and be responsible for developing and executing the company’s marketing strategy to support our growth and revenue objectives.

The ideal candidate will have a strong background in growing a B2B SaaS business, with a proven track record of driving revenue growth through innovative marketing strategies.

This role requires an exceptional leader who is a creative thinker, a data-driven strategist, and an excellent communicator. You’ll be part of the Senior Leadership team, expected to bring knowledge and market awareness to your peers and work closely with your counterparts to drive the company’s overall success.

Responsibilities

  • Develop and execute the company’s marketing strategy to support business objectives
  • Define and track KPI’s for marketing activities and report on their success
  • Develop the companies brand identity and ensure it is consistent across the business and communicated across all marketing channels
  • Conduct market analysis to identify customer needs, marketing trends and competitor activity in the B2B SaaS Sales intelligence space
  • Identify competitors and evaluate their strategies and positioning and devise counter-strategies
  • Manage the marketing budget, allocate resources effectively, and ensure that marketing activities are delivering a positive ROI
  • Manage, shape and develop a high performing marketing team, analyzing its structure and personnel to ensure we are set for success
  • Ensure compliance with all marketing regulations and standards, for legal matters consult with our General Counsel
  • Work closely with the sales department to align sales and marketing strategies
  • Serve as a key member of the executive leadership team, providing insights and recommendations on business strategy and company direction.

Requirements

  • 10+ years of experience in marketing, with a focus on B2B SaaS marketing and demand generation, ideally within the sales intelligence or data space.
  • Proven track record of driving revenue growth through effective marketing strategies and campaigns.
  • Excellent understanding of Go-To-Market platforms, strategies and the tools companies in the B2B space are leveraging to identify and close business.
  • Inspiring and strong leadership and communication skills, with the ability to motivate and lead a team
  • Strong analytical and quantitative skills, providing accountability for generating pipeline and leads to achieve revenue targets.
  • Experience with marketing automation tools, digital marketing and social media
  • Ability to work collaboratively with cross-functional teams and senior leadership
  • Experience with both PLG (product led growth) and SLG (sales led growth) go-to-market motions
  • Work with all go-to-market teams to build and maintain our story/message and enhance their efforts with digital marketing campaigns.
  • Experience of B2B Marketing of a platform/suite of products
  • Metric-driven, success-driven, passionate, go-getter attitude
  • An entrepreneurial spirit and ability to drive results autonomously in a hypergrowth environment.
